Transaction 12760d74077bfc77a2cff49e8cbf34994fcd9023afa6917ef427d95d353482c3

2 Input
1 Outputs
  • 12760d74077bfc77a2cff49e8cbf34994fcd9023afa6917ef427d95d353482c3:0
  • value  759905
    address  1M4DpkvntEZXVpnzqCFwDhmk6nXtqSrZp1